Both of these are built specifically for maid services, so this comparison is really about company stage, not category. ZenMaid prices in flat tiers for owner-operators and small teams; MaidCentral is an operating system for established cleaning companies, starting at $450 per month plus a one-time onboarding fee.
How they differ
The ten-times price gap is not a pricing mistake — the two products are aimed at different companies.
ZenMaid runs $19 to $49 per month with SMS billed separately. MaidCentral's published starting price is $450 per month — $5,400 per year — before a one-time onboarding fee. They are not bidding for the same buyer.
ZenMaid assumes an owner running the schedule personally, possibly with a small office. MaidCentral assumes an established, often multi-location company with office staff who will run KPIs, payroll, and revenue planning inside the system.
MaidCentral ships KPI dashboards, revenue planning, payroll management, marketing automation, and rate-adjustment tooling, with onboarding support included. ZenMaid covers scheduling, booking forms, messaging, and payroll reports on its higher tiers.
ZenMaid is self-serve with a 14-day trial and a free 1:1 data transfer. MaidCentral publishes no long-term contract requirement, but its onboarding fee and process are a real investment — you adopt it as an operating decision, not an experiment.
The math
There is no team size where these two prices converge, so the useful comparison is what the totals buy.
| Plan | Monthly | Per year | What the price leaves out |
|---|---|---|---|
| ZenMaid Pro | $39 | $468 | SMS charges billed separately; booking forms carry ZenMaid branding. |
| ZenMaid Pro Max | $49 | $588 | SMS charges billed separately. |
| MaidCentral | $450 to start | $5,400+ | Plus a one-time onboarding fee; unlimited users and customers included. |
| Cleanr — the third option | $39, or $24.92 effective on yearly billing | $299 flat | Cleaning-only software; whole crew included. Card processing applies only when customers pay invoices online. |
If you will actively use MaidCentral's scorecards, payroll management, and revenue planning across an office team, the platform is priced for the value of running a larger company on it. If those tools would sit idle, the gap buys nothing — and ZenMaid or a flat-priced option covers the operational core for a tenth of the cost.
Feature by feature
Drawn from each product's published pricing and feature pages.
| Capability | ZenMaid | MaidCentral |
|---|---|---|
| Built for | Owner-operators and small maid-service teams | Established and multi-location residential cleaning companies |
| Pricing model | Three flat tiers, $19–$49/month; SMS charges extra on all | From $450/month plus a one-time onboarding fee |
| Users | Flat tiers — no per-cleaner charge | Unlimited users and customers |
| Business analytics | Reports on Pro and higher | KPI dashboards, scorecards, and revenue planning |
| Payroll | Payroll tools and reports on Pro and higher | Payroll management built in |
| Marketing tooling | Automated customer messaging by tier | Marketing automation and rate-adjustment tools |
| Getting started | Self-serve, 14-day trial, free 1:1 transfer advertised | Guided onboarding included, behind the onboarding fee |
